Output 8c8ecae5b99557eb2afa620de6d6e4a4d95e02aa352e9ea642135ea376f828d7:0

value
20959864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c6b206308923af8af0ec2958b9b0facee52f150 OP_EQUAL
address
3MnUv2Wqpq1jvbh1qpnPaqWPaNYfX59zjV
transaction
8c8ecae5b99557eb2afa620de6d6e4a4d95e02aa352e9ea642135ea376f828d7
spent
true